A Low-RCS Holographic Metasurface Antenna Based on Transmissive/absorptive Metasurface

A holographic metasurface antenna with out-band radar cross-section (RCS) reduction using transmissive/absorptive metasurface is proposed in this paper. The holographic metasurface antenna is fed by a monopole that works at 11.5GHz. The transmissive and absorptive two layers of the metasurface are placed above the antenna. The absorptive metasurface can absorb incident waves and realize the RCS reduction when the antenna is working, the electromagnetic (EM) waves radiated by the antenna can pass through the transmissive layer.
